The fuel economy of Foton 21 meters aerial work vehicle compared with the national five and earlier emission standards of vehicles has indeed been significantly improved, mainly due to the following characteristics of the national six engine:
1. More efficient fuel management system
Optimization of fuel injection technology: the sixth engine adopts
a more refined fuel injection control system, which can adjust the
fuel injection amount in real time according to the load and speed,
improve combustion efficiency and reduce fuel waste.
Electronic Control Unit (ECU) optimization: The sixth engine is
equipped with a more intelligent electronic control system that can
intelligently adjust engine operating parameters according to
driving and load conditions, making fuel consumption more
economical.
2. Low emission design
The relationship between low emissions and fuel economy: the
emission requirements of the National Six standards promote the
engine to reduce emissions during the optimized combustion process,
so as to improve fuel efficiency and reduce the emission of harmful
substances. Improved technologies such as exhaust gas recirculation
(EGR) and selective catalytic reduction (SCR) further increase fuel
efficiency.
3. Balance of power and fuel consumption
Efficient power output: While improving power output, the national
Six engine can better control fuel consumption to ensure the
balance between power demand and fuel consumption. For Foton's
21-meter high-altitude working vehicle, this means that it can
reduce fuel consumption while maintaining high work efficiency.
Load sensing regulation: The collaborative optimization of the
hydraulic system and the power system enables the aerial work
vehicle to achieve better fuel efficiency under different loads.
For example, at light loads, the engine automatically reduces power
output, saving fuel.
4. Lower engine friction and internal friction
Engine design optimization: The Guo6 engine design focuses on
reducing internal friction and heat loss, and uses a more efficient
lubrication system to further reduce fuel consumption.
5. Overall vehicle design and lightweight
Vehicle design optimization: Foton 21 meters aerial work vehicle in
the overall design has been optimized, especially in the body
weight and aerodynamics have been improved, reducing the weight of
the vehicle, improve fuel economy.
Hydraulic system efficiency improvements: Hydraulic systems are
designed to be more efficient, reducing energy loss during use and
thereby improving fuel economy.
